PLATE 10. A–F in Phylogeny and systematics of the leafhopper subfamily Ledrinae (Hemiptera: Cicadellidae) 2186
PLATE 10. A–F, Characters and states in analysis: face in ventral aspect, cont. A. R. informis: (1) crown margin not carinate. B. S. depressa: (1) antennal ledge appearing pinched or wrinkle-like; (2) frontoclypeus marginal sutures widely divergent and (3) crossing bar in front of antennae; (4) antennal pit inner margin a bar continuous with frontoclypeus, 45°; (5) genal rugosities. C. Titiella humerosa (Naudé): (1) suture between frontoclypeus and genae weakly developed. D. Thlasia obtusa (Walker): (1) lora/genae tumid and angulate; (2) apex of frontoclypeus flexed ventrad; (3) antennal pit inner margin somewhat well developed, approximately parallel to frontoclypeus. E. X. tuberculata: (1) frontoclypeus medially angulate, punctate; (2) antennal ledge a thin carina. F. X. viridis: (1) frontoclypeus broad throughout; (2) antennal pit inner margin a thin ridge; (3) proepisternum long and narrow. G–I, Characters and states in analysis: face in anterior aspect. G. P. raniceps: (1) crown transverse camber weakly curved. H. B. peculiaris: (1) crown transverse camber depressed adjacent to midline. I. P. acuminata: (1) crown transverse camber sharply angled.
